What Is Labradorite? An Introduction to the Stone of Magic #

Labradorite is a captivating feldspar mineral cherished for its remarkable play of color, a phenomenon known as labradorescence. As light strikes the stone from different angles, it reflects in dazzling flashes of blue, green, gold, and sometimes purple, creating an effect reminiscent of the Aurora Borealis. This stunning optical effect is not a surface color but rather light refracting from within the layers of the stone, giving it a mystical depth and an otherworldly appearance.

Labradorite Mineralogical Properties #

PropertyDetail
Chemical Composition(Na,Ca)(Al,Si)4O8
Crystal SystemTriclinic
Mohs Hardness6 – 6.5
LusterVitreous to pearly
Color RangeDark grey to grey-black base with iridescent flashes (labradorescence) of blue, green, gold, orange, and purple.
Major SourcesCanada, Madagascar, Finland, Norway, Russia

History and Lore of Labradorite #

Labradorite was first discovered in 1770 on the Isle of Paul in Labrador, Canada, from which it gets its name. However, its lore is much older, with deep roots in the traditions of the Inuit people of the region.

According to Inuit legend, the vibrant colors of the Aurora Borealis were once trapped within the rocks along the coast. It is said that a mighty Inuit warrior struck the stones with his spear, releasing the lights into the sky. Some of the light, however, remained frozen within the stone, giving birth to the magical gem we now know as Labradorite. This ancient story perfectly captures the stone’s mystical essence and its connection to the unseen worlds of light and spirit.

How can you tell if Labradorite is real? #

Real Labradorite is identified by its labradorescence—the distinct flash of color that appears as you move the stone in the light. This flash should appear to come from within the stone. Fakes often have a uniform, painted-on sheen that sits on the surface and does not change with the viewing angle.

Can Labradorite go in water? #

Labradorite can be rinsed in water for a short period, but it should not be soaked. As a feldspar mineral with a layered structure, prolonged exposure to water can cause it to degrade or fracture over time.
